New Dog Crates and Kennels for 2018

New Dog Crates and Kennels for 2018

The evolution of the dog crate is proof of how we view our sporting dogs these days versus just a couple of decades ago. Today's kennels are almost universally built to nearly bomb-proof standards, and while most are clearly crafted with an eye toward safety, they are also built for comfort.

This is because our hunting dogs are far more than just pointers, flushers and retrievers; they are a part of the family. This means that while they are at home or on the road with us, they deserve proper care and treatment. Fortunately, there are plenty of companies with the same view, and they have churned out some killer products for 2018.

Gunner Kennels G1 Medium

Gunner Kennels G1 MediumThe problem with a lot of the available crates out there is that they are simply too big for many of the upland breeds. The minds behind Gunner Kennels clearly noticed this and decided to do something about it because they've released their new G1 Medium. This nearly indestructible kennel is designed to fit dogs that weigh up to about 45 pounds. It's also backed by a lifetime warranty, made right here in the USA, and boasts a Five-Star Crash Test Rating. If you're running a springer or a Brittany or an English setter or any of the other mid-sized upland hunting breeds out there, this is the crate for you.

Avery Quick-Set Fabric Kennel

Avery Quick-Set Fabric KennelThe problem with a lot of kennels is they are anything but portable. This is not the case with ASD's Quick-Set Fabric Kennel. This collapsible kennel is built on a lightweight aluminum frame that folds up easily for storage and transport. Four sizes of the Quick-Set are offered, as are a couple of camouflage choices, and you can rest assured that this over-the-road must-have will fit in your vehicle no matter whether you drive a truck, SUV, or even a car.

Custom Molding Easy Loader

Custom Molding Easy LoaderCustom Molding Services is no stranger to producing high-quality dog products and it's pretty hard to beat their Easy Loader. This double dog kennel will fit all standard pickups and large SUVs, and is designed with high-density polyethylene, meaning it is nearly bombproof. To further ensure that you'll get years and years of usage out of your Easy Loader, each is created with an Ultra Violet Stabilizer, which keeps the kennel from breaking down or cracking.

Canine Cargo Carrier Honeycomb

Canine Cargo Carrier HoneycombCrates are a necessity, but they are also usually bulky and not all that accommodating when it comes to saving space. The Honeycomb Dog Boxes allow you to stack quite a few before running into space issues, but the best combo for most sporting dog owners might be a three-box pod, which will fit in-between the wheel wells of most pickups. This also allows for storage underneath the middle box.

Ruff Tough Intermediate SUV

Ruff Tough Intermediate SUVI spend my fall in a full-sized pickup, but a good bird-hunting buddy of mine drives an SUV. I'm always amazed at the difference in how we have to pack and crate our dogs when he drives on a trip versus when I do. Fortunately for him and other SUV fans, there are crate options out their like the latest from Ruff Tough. Their intermediate SUV kennel measures 31" long and 20" wide (23" tall), weighs only 18 pounds, and is designed with a top back edge cut-out in order to fit most SUVs and crossovers.

Dakota283 Framed Dog Kennel

Dakota283 Framed Dog KennelTo ensure the Framed Dog Kennel will survive loads of abuse, it is molded from one solid piece and outfitted with a keyed paddle latching door. It is also designed with an easy-grip handle, easy-to-clean drain hold, and recesses in case you need to stack crates. Three sizes — medium, large and x-large — are offered to accommodate dogs of all sizes, and you can choose between five different crate colors that include granite, desert sand, olive, orange and coyote tan.

NorthStar 901E Dog Boxes

NorthStar 901E Dog BoxesNorthStar produces a lot of really cool dog transport options, but one of the best for the upland crowd has to be the 901E, which is constructed of durable high-density polyethylene plastic. These extremely rugged dog boxes are much cooler in summer and warmer in the winter than metal boxes, are very easy to load and unload, and provide a dry, comfortable environment throughout transportation. They also feature fully removable floor panels, drip trays, and a center divider for easy cleaning and customization.

K-9 Kondo Chew-Proof Dog Door

K-9 Kondo Chew-Proof Dog DoorThe Igloo Dog House is a popular option for housing dogs and K-9 Kondo has figured out a way to make it even better by creating their Chew-Proof Dog Door. This add-on features a six-inch rain shield, a heavy-duty design, and is made-in-the-USA. K-9 Kondo also offers up Dog Den kennels (starting at $340), which are built-to-last and decked out with insulating foam that is built into the ceiling and floor. Choose from two sizes of the Dog Den to house sporting dogs weighing up to 110 pounds.

Kennel Deck

Kennel DeckIf you have an outdoor kennel or a few dog runs, or just need a place to keep your dog high and dry then check out Kennel Deck, which is molded from high-density plastic resins. This, along with its unique design, allows it circulate air, drain easily, and provide warmth to your dog. It also sports a non-skid surface and will not absorb odors. I bought a section (2'x4'x2") for our trailer at the lake to use under the outdoor shower to hose off my Lab and my kids, and it's perfect for the job. Each section weighs only 8.5 pounds and can hold up to 1000 pounds.

Mason Company Chain Link Runs

Mason Company Chain Link RunsNot everyone lets their bird dog sleep in the bed with them at night. Some folks still prefer a quality dog run, like those offered by Mason Company. Their unique offerings allow you to truly customize an individual run, or connect multiple runs. Choose from four different diamond opening mesh sizes as well as three wire gauges, which are designed to be smooth to the touch and not covered in sharp edges or burs. If chain-link runs aren't your thing, don't fret. Mason Company offers a ton of different indoor and outdoor kennel options.

Redwing Hound Haulers

Redwing Hound HaulersPerhaps you've got a bird dog that needs to visit a trainer four states away but really don't want to make the trip yourself? Give Redwing Hound Haulers a call. For over two decades they've been safely transporting dogs of all varieties across the country in a clean and climate-controlled truck. Redwing provides food and bedding, and will transport pups as well, meaning that if you should find that English setter litter with the right pedigree but it happens to be 500 miles away, they'll deliver it to your doorstep.

Jones Trailer Company WJ

Jones Trailer Company WJIf you're lucky enough to spend the first part of your fall hunting roosters in the Dakotas and the second part deep in quail country, you might want to consider a WJ Model trailer from Jones Trailer Company — especially if you're running a few dogs. This high-quality trailer is decked out with a litany of features like full insulation, an exhaust fan, adjustable louver door vents, dog tie out loops, and a raised top storage area among many, many others. Choose from four-, six- or eight-stall models and a host of custom options.
